So, I explained away my symptoms or minimized them. It was only later, when they became persistent enough that I couldn\u2019t ignore them, that I finally sought treatment.\u201d\u00a0<\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/www.mdanderson.org\/cancerwise\/three-time-cancer-lymphoma-survivor--why-i-keep-returning-to-md-anderson.h00-159382734.html\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Robert Harris<\/a> was 76 when he was diagnosed with stage III colorectal cancer. \u201cI started having <a href=\"https:\/\/www.mdanderson.org\/cancerwise\/hematochezia-vs--melena--what-s-the-difference.h00-159774078.html\" target=\"_self\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">dark stools<\/a> and a little pain in my lower abdomen, so I called my family doctor,\u201d says the retired army veteran and project manager. \u201cShe thought it might be my <a href=\"https:\/\/www.mdanderson.org\/cancerwise\/4-appendix-cancer-questions-answered.h00-159463212.html\" target=\"_self\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">appendix<\/a>, since the pain was on my right side, so she brought me in for a check-up. But then she did a digital exam and said there was blood in my stool.\u201d\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Diarrhea\u202f\u00a0<\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/www.mdanderson.org\/cancerwise\/how-colorectal-cancer-treatment-improved-my-quality-of-life.h00-159387468.html\" target=\"_self\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Courtney Nash<\/a>, who was 35 when she was diagnosed with stage III colorectal cancer, had been dealing with chronic diarrhea, frequent stomach aches and other digestive issues for more than 20 years due to <a href=\"https:\/\/www.mdanderson.org\/cancerwise\/does-ulcerative-colitis-affect-your-colorectal-cancer-risk.h00-159462423.html\" target=\"_self\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">ulcerative colitis<\/a>.\u202f\u202f\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>\u201cBut after the birth of my second daughter, my symptoms increased dramatically,\u201d says Courtney, a sugar cane farmer from Harlingen, Texas. \u201cI started dropping weight, losing my hair and even passing blood occasionally.\u201d\u202f\u202f\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Constipation or problems having a bowel movement\u202f\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I was pregnant with my second child when I began having constipation,\u201d recalls <a href=\"https:\/\/www.mdanderson.org\/cancerwise\/my-body-changes-during-pregnancy-were-rectal-cancer-symptoms.h00-159385890.html\" target=\"_self\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Catherine Wright<\/a>, a stay-at-home mom from Florida who was 33 when she was diagnosed with stage III colorectal cancer. \u201cEach night, I\u2019d wake up with an urgent need to go to the bathroom. But then I\u2019d sit on the toilet, unable to empty my bowels. It was annoying and interfered with my sleep.\u201d\u00a0 \u00a0<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I thought the inconsistent stools I was experiencing were from diet changes I\u2019d made,\u201d adds graphic designer <a href=\"https:\/\/www.mdanderson.org\/cancerwise\/20-year-old-patient--you-re-never-too-young-to-get-colorectal-cancer.h00-159538956.html\" target=\"_self\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Jaystan Davis<\/a>, who was only 19 when he was diagnosed with stage IV colorectal cancer. \u201cI was scared and very confused.\u201d\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Unexplained and unexpected weight loss\u202f\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>\u201cMost people get a bit heavier over the holidays,\u201d notes <a href=\"https:\/\/www.mdanderson.org\/cancerwise\/retired-physician-colorectal-cancer-survivor-i-wish-i-d-gotten-a-colonoscopy-sooner.h00-159303834.html\" target=\"_self\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Kenneth Rolston, M.D.<\/a>, a retired MD Anderson infectious diseases specialist who was 66 when he was diagnosed with stage I colorectal cancer. \u201cBut I\u2019d been <a href=\"https:\/\/www.mdanderson.org\/cancerwise\/cancer-treatment-side-effect--involuntary-weight-loss.h00-159384312.html\" target=\"_self\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">losing weight steadily<\/a> for about four months by early 2017. And I was not trying to. I was also experiencing fatigue.\u201d\u202f\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Kenneth finally made an appointment after his wife looked across the dinner table at him one night and said, \u201cYou are literally melting away before my eyes. What\u2019s it going to take to get you to go to the doctor?\u201d\u202f\u202f\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Don\u2019t wait to call your doctor if you see any of these symptoms\u202f\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Colorectal cancer symptoms such as diarrhea, constipation, bloating and fatigue are common and non-specific enough that they could be caused by any number of conditions.<\/p>\n<p>But if you experience one or more of the following \u201calarm symptoms,\u201d consider it a red flag and contact your doctor immediately.\u202f\u202f\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Things like diarrhea and constipation are so general that they could be due to many possible causes,\u201d notes Richards. \u201cNone of them necessarily means that you have colorectal cancer. But if a symptom is persistent, rather than a one-time issue, it should at least warrant a conversation with your doctor.
